Past time for science to visit Burger King
Froot Loops Milkshake and Lucky Charms Milkshake : literally take chunks of cereal and mix in their 'white icing' icecream
Loops tasted surprisingly like Fruity Pebbles; Charms like cereal milk. I haven't found a purpose for them; niche at best.
Loops: 4/10
Charms: 3.5/10

Mac N' Cheetos the second time around on these for me weren't as charming. Tasted almost burnt. Only ok, but still expense: 3.75/10

Crispy Chicken Sandwich has been advertised for awhile now, but this has been my first time getting to it. It had an excellent crisp crunch. The chicken inside was thick and juicy. Every bite was enjoyable. The bun was bready, which is value-added filler. I entered a food coma upon completion. 6/10.
